FreightWaves app update creates interactive experience

FreightWaves has released an update to its mobile app, bringing all of its editorial, video and audio podcast content to one location. Readers and listeners will now be able to consume and share supply chain content from the FreightWaves News app, with updated features for group discussions and community building.

Hot Freight Opinions: Reaction to Uber Freight acquiring Transplace

On Thursday, Uber Freight announced the acquisition of Transplace for $2.25 billion, a deal the companies say will “create one of the leading logistics technology platforms, with one of the largest and most comprehensive managed transportation and logistics networks in the world.”

We asked FreightWaves experts to provide us their Hot Freight Opinions (HFOs) on the deal:
